The Attribution Gap Only 36% of marketers can accurately tie content to revenue. That number comes from CMI's 2025 B2B Content Marketing Trends report, and it has been cited repeatedly through early 2026 analyses because it keeps proving accurate. More than half of all B2B marketers — 56% — cannot attribute ROI to their content efforts at all.
